Chelsea have been informed by Juventus that they can buy Alex Sandro for a price of just £50 million – according to reports.

Juventus had quoted a price of about £70 million when Chelsea came calling for Sandro during the summer but now it seems that the Old Lady are willing to reduce that price tag.

Juventus wished that Sandro would end the current season in Italy after which they were ready to hear bids for the Brazilian. But the left-back seems to have put his foot down and wants to move out of the club in January itself.

Premier League clubs like Manchester United and Chelsea have both shown an interest in Sandro but Juventus know very well that if they were to quote £70 million not too many clubs will be interested in signing him up. Now through their revised price tag of £50 million is sure to attract a long of buyers during the January transfer window.

Manchester United manager Jose Mourinho wants to sign a quality left-back and Spurs’ outcast Danny Rose was supposed to be their primary target but now with Sandro coming in the same price bracket as Rose, United are sure to give a tough competition to Chelsea in the signing of the Brazilian.

Antonio Conte has reportedly been given the go-ahead by the Chelsea board to sign a couple of players during the January transfer window and with a £50 million price tag, the Blues are sure to go after Sandro.
